Which Greek painter is nicknamed 'The Greek' and painted View of Toledo?

Explanation:
The painter nicknamed “The Greek” who painted View of Toledo is El Greco, the Greek-born Domenikos Theotokopoulos. Born on Crete, he moved to Spain and settled in Toledo, where he earned the name El Greco to reflect his origins. He’s famous for a dramatic, elongated style and intense, spiritual mood, and View of Toledo is one of his best-known landscapes, showing the city on a moody, luminous day—an unusual and striking subject for him.
